Racemic Alanine
A mixture of equal parts of the D- and L-enantiomers of alanine, making it optically inactive due to the internal compensation of optical activity.
Acetaldehyde
A volatile, colorless, and flammable liquid organic compound, used as an intermediate in the synthesis of various chemicals.
3-Methylthiopropanal
An organic compound characterized by a three-carbon aldehyde functional group attached to a sulfur atom-containing methyl group.
Methionine
An essential amino acid that plays a role in many cellular processes, such as initiating protein synthesis and being a source of sulfur.
